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Setting top to : /tmp/tmpe1Iv_6
- Setting out to : /tmp/tmpe1Iv_6/build
- Checking for program webpack : /app/node_modules/.bin/webpack
- ERROR: Multiple versions of the same package are not supported by the Pebble SDK due to namespace issues during linking. Package 'socket.io' contains the following duplicate and incompatible dependencies, which may lead to additional build errors and/or unpredictable runtime behavior:
- 'redis': '0.6.6'
- Found Pebble SDK for diorite in: : /app/sdk3/pebble/diorite
- Checking for program gcc,cc : arm-none-eabi-gcc
- Checking for program ar : arm-none-eabi-ar
- 'configure' finished successfully (0.164s)
- Waf: Entering directory `/tmp/tmpe1Iv_6/build'
- [ 1/16] message_key_header: -> build/include/message_keys.auto.h
- [ 2/16] diorite | subst: ../../app/sdk3/pebble/common/pebble_app.ld.template -> build/diorite/pebble_app.ld.auto
- [ 3/16] diorite | appinfo.auto.c: -> build/diorite/appinfo.auto.c
- [ 4/16] diorite | appinfo.json: -> build/appinfo.json
- [ 5/16] diorite | resource_ball: -> build/diorite/system_resources.resball
- [ 7/16] diorite | generate_resource_id_definitions: build/diorite/system_resources.resball -> build/diorite/src/resource_ids.auto.c
- [ 8/16] diorite | generate_resource_id_header: build/diorite/system_resources.resball -> build/diorite/src/resource_ids.auto.h
- [ 8/16] diorite | generate_pbpack: build/diorite/system_resources.resball -> build/diorite/app_resources.pbpack
- [ 9/16] diorite | c: build/diorite/src/resource_ids.auto.c -> build/diorite/src/resource_ids.auto.c.9.o
- [10/16] diorite | c: build/diorite/appinfo.auto.c -> build/diorite/appinfo.auto.c.9.o
- [11/16] diorite | c: src/c/main.c -> build/src/c/main.c.9.o
- [12/16] diorite | cprogram: build/src/c/main.c.9.o build/diorite/appinfo.auto.c.9.o build/diorite/src/resource_ids.auto.c.9.o -> build/diorite/pebble-app.elf
- /app/arm-cs-tools/bin/../lib/gcc/arm-none-eabi/4.7.3/../../../../arm-none-eabi/bin/ld: warning: cannot find entry symbol main; not setting start address
- [13/16] diorite | memory_usage_report: build/diorite/pebble-app.elf build/diorite/app_resources.pbpack
- -------------------------------------------------------
- DIORITE APP MEMORY USAGE
- Total size of resources: 4092 bytes / 256KB
- Total footprint in RAM: 172 bytes / 64KB
- Free RAM available (heap): 65364 bytes
- -------------------------------------------------------
- [14/16] diorite | pebble-app.raw.bin: build/diorite/pebble-app.elf -> build/diorite/pebble-app.raw.bin
- [15/16] diorite | inject-metadata: build/diorite/pebble-app.raw.bin build/diorite/pebble-app.elf build/diorite/app_resources.pbpack -> build/diorite/pebble-app.bin
- Waf: Leaving directory `/tmp/tmpe1Iv_6/build'
- Build failed
- Traceback (most recent call last):
- File "/app/sdk3/pebble/.waf-1.7.11-951087d39789950ed009f0c86ce75e7b/waflib/Task.py", line 123, in process
- ret=self.run()
- File "/app/sdk3/pebble/.waf-1.7.11-951087d39789950ed009f0c86ce75e7b/waflib/Task.py", line 47, in run
- return m1(self)
- File "/app/sdk3/pebble/.waf-1.7.11-951087d39789950ed009f0c86ce75e7b/waflib/extras/pebble_sdk_gcc.py", line 39, in inject_data_rule
- inject_metadata.inject_metadata(tgt_path,elf_path,res_path,timestamp,allow_js=has_pkjs,has_worker=has_worker)
- File "/app/sdk3/pebble/common/tools/inject_metadata.py", line 211, in inject_metadata
- raise Exception("Missing app entry point! Must be `int main(void) { ... }` ")
- Exception: Missing app entry point! Must be `int main(void) { ... }`
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ement